Dubai is famous for its opulence, and this extends to the automotive scene. While sleek frames and powerful engines are essential, the ultimate driving experience is achieved by a top-tier exhaust system. These https://www.masterlineautoexhaust.com/
UAE's Smoothest Ride: Top-Tier Exhaust Systems
Internet 161 days ago zakariaogri900125Web Directory Categories
Web Directory Search
New Site Listings